Role overview
The Product Manager owns the enterprise product vision and guides prioritization through discovery, backlog management, and roadmap execution. You will study business, users, and customers, validate problems and opportunities with qualitative and quantitative data, and ensure risks to value, viability, feasibility, and usability are addressed early.
Responsibilities
- Own the product vision for the enterprise and align your team around delivery of high-value business outcomes.
- Develop and maintain discovery and delivery backlogs, roadmaps, and prioritized problem statements.
- Study business needs, user behavior, customer needs, pain points, and business constraints, including observing what users do to uncover insights.
- Use qualitative and quantitative, data-driven methods to shape priorities and feature definitions.
- Mine multiple data sources to validate problems and opportunities for solutioning and ensure the team is solving the right problems.
- Collaborate with engineering and design during discovery to identify and validate solutions to prioritized problems, addressing risks up front.
- Serve as Product Owner on scrum delivery teams, working with engineering and design to resolve in-sprint issues and challenges.
- Directly supervise Product Analysts and lead their growth through coaching and support.
- Drive product success at the enterprise level by supporting user adoption and collaborating with stakeholders and other technology and product teams to maximize business value.
- Align stakeholders across the enterprise on strategies, manage conflict, and maintain transparent prioritization of needs and roadmap status.
- Work with the product team and portfolio leader to define and align product team OKRs.
- Perform analysis on technical, operational, and market considerations for new product development and differentiation.
- Act as the voice of the product(s) to senior management and stakeholders.
- Build deep business domain expertise to identify opportunities to improve or expand digital capabilities aligned with strategy.
- Identify emerging market and technology needs.
- May be assigned an Electric Utilities emergency and storm role, including work after-hours during storms and other emergencies that impact customer service.
- Comply with all policies and standards, and perform other duties as assigned.
